Their claim concerns field-of-use scope; our counsel considers their position weak but expects a settlement offer before arbitration. Escrowed royalties now total one quarter's payments. Key dates: mediation in six weeks, arbitration filing deadline two weeks after. Avoid direct contact with Farrowgate staff pending counsel's guidance. The confidential note on affected business plans is appended below.

board note of yadup-fajef: Druiusox Holdings is in early talks to buy Norwynek Systems for about $186.0 million. The Kaseth launch date is June 24, and nothing goes to the press before then. Legal wants the Quenethek Group term sheet withdrawn before November 27.

Visitor policy note: the Brightmoor Labs intern cohort arrives on the first Monday of the month and will be escorted from reception by their programme lead. Facilities should issue temporary lanyards at the desk and record each name against the cohort list. Interns may not access the server corridor unescorted. For the duration of their stay, the training-wing door code is as follows.

staff pass of kawip-hawef = bdg-QLP-2

## Undo and Redo in Sketchloom

Sketchloom keeps a per-canvas history of the last 200 actions, so support agents should reassure users that most accidental deletions are recoverable with undo. Note that history clears when a diagram is closed, and collaborative edits by other users cannot be undone from your session. A complete list of undoable actions and known limitations is maintained on the internal page.

runbook for badug-kadup: https://confluence.zemvarlabs.internal/projects/browse/display/projects/bd1b

The GiftNote mailer batches receipt PDFs and sends them through the Larkpost relay. If the relay backs up, the worker retries with jittered backoff and parks failures in the dead-letter queue after the cap. Before touching retry behavior during an incident, check the current tuning values, which are listed below.

constants for bawif-kawif:
QUOTAS = {
    "ulaael": 5,
    "holael": 10,
}

Ticket: Signature verification failed when publishing the order-events schema to the Varnwick Schema Registry. The registry rejected the payload because the manifest was signed with a rotated key that expired last Tuesday. Ingestion is blocked for the Lanmere pipeline until re-signed. Please re-sign the manifest using the current key, shown below.

release key, bawig-kahip: bky4_bSxn